Welcome to a new series of Realising Your Potential.
Every week Anj speaks to inspiring women about their leadership journeys, the challenges they’ve faced and the lessons they’ve learnt. Together they explore what organisations can do to drive gender equality and how we can all realise our potential.
In the final episode of this series, Anj speaks with none other than June Sarpong OBE, a true trailblazer. June has had an amazing career: she's been one of the most recognisable faces on British television; she's written the award-winning books "Diversify," "The Power of Women," and "The Power of Privilege" (with a fourth book, "The Only One in the Room," coming out in Summer 2022); and she's hosted some historical events such as Nelson Mandela's 90th birthday, interviewed some of the world's biggest names, and worked extensively with Prince Charles as an ambassador for the Prince's Trust.
Today, Anj and June cover everything from affirmations to the pivotal moments that inspired June to write Diversify, as well as tons of practical advice on how to have better conversations about diversity and inclusion as an organisation, team, or individual.
